[rtems-crossrpms commit] Obsolete arm-rtemseabi4.11.

Ralf Corsepius ralf at rtems.org
Thu May 30 03:28:28 UTC 2013


Module:    rtems-crossrpms
Branch:    master
Commit:    31ae7bcd2d5837f1c2bb44b7ec4a2f9ca657d53a
Changeset: http://git.rtems.org/rtems-crossrpms/commit/?id=31ae7bcd2d5837f1c2bb44b7ec4a2f9ca657d53a

Author:    Ralf Corsépius <ralf.corsepius at rtems.org>
Date:      Tue May 28 08:36:14 2013 +0200

Obsolete arm-rtemseabi4.11.

---

 binutils/binutils.add   |    4 ++++
 gcc/gccnewlib.add       |    5 +++++
 gcc/target-c++.add      |    8 ++++++++
 gcc/target-gcc.add      |    4 ++++
 gcc/target-gcj.add      |    4 ++++
 gcc/target-gfortran.add |    8 ++++++++
 gcc/target-gnat.add     |    4 ++++
 gcc/target-go.add       |    4 ++++
 gcc/target-newlib.add   |    4 ++++
 gcc/target-objc.add     |    8 ++++++++
 gdb/gdb.add             |    5 +++++
 11 files changed, 58 insertions(+), 0 deletions(-)

diff --git a/binutils/binutils.add b/binutils/binutils.add
index 7b27650..70f00bc 100644
--- a/binutils/binutils.add
+++ b/binutils/binutils.add
@@ -32,6 +32,10 @@ BuildRequires:	bison
 %if %build_infos
 
 Requires:	@rpmprefix at binutils-common
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-binutils <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-binutils = %{version}-%{release}
+%endif
 %endif
 
 @SOURCES@
diff --git a/gcc/gccnewlib.add b/gcc/gccnewlib.add
index 6846495..bb68cb0 100644
--- a/gcc/gccnewlib.add
+++ b/gcc/gccnewlib.add
@@ -263,6 +263,11 @@ Source62:    ftp://ftp.gnu.org/gnu/gmp/gmp-%{gmp_version}.tar.bz2
 Source63:    http://www.mr511.de/software/libelf-%{libelf_version}.tar.gz
 %endif
 
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c = %{version}-%{release}
+
+%endif
 %description
 Cross gcc for @tool_target at .
 
diff --git a/gcc/target-c++.add b/gcc/target-c++.add
index f8fce19..6df87f0 100644
--- a/gcc/target-c++.add
+++ b/gcc/target-c++.add
@@ -17,6 +17,10 @@ BuildRequires:  @rpmprefix@@tool_target at -gcc-c++ = %{gcc_rpmvers}
 Requires:       @rpmprefix at gcc-common
 %endif
 Requires:       @rpmprefix@@tool_target at -gcc = %{gcc_rpmvers}-%{release}
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-c++ <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-c++ =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-c++
 GCC c++ compiler for @tool_target at .
@@ -28,6 +32,10 @@ Group:		Development/Tools
 Version:        %{gcc_rpmvers}
 %{?_with_noarch_subpackages:BuildArch: noarch}
 License:	GPL
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-libstdc++ <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-libstdc++ =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-libstdc++
 %{summary}
diff --git a/gcc/target-gcc.add b/gcc/target-gcc.add
index ff7cf12..7223db8 100644
--- a/gcc/target-gcc.add
+++ b/gcc/target-gcc.add
@@ -26,6 +26,10 @@ Version:        %{gcc_rpmvers}
 %{?_with_noarch_subpackages:BuildArch: noarch}
 Requires:       @rpmprefix@@tool_target at -newlib = %{newlib_version}- at NEWLIB_RPMREL@
 License:	GPL
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-libgcc <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-libgcc =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-libgcc
 libgcc @tool_target at -gcc.
diff --git a/gcc/target-gcj.add b/gcc/target-gcj.add
index 0ea7735..5111a06 100644
--- a/gcc/target-gcj.add
+++ b/gcc/target-gcj.add
@@ -12,6 +12,10 @@ License:	GPL
 Requires:       @rpmprefix at gcc-gcj-common
 %endif
 Requires:       @rpmprefix@@tool_target at -gcc = %{gcc_rpmvers}-%{release}
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cj <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cj =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-gcj
 RTEMS is an open source operating system for embedded systems.
diff --git a/gcc/target-gfortran.add b/gcc/target-gfortran.add
index 81d5d48..b63d129 100644
--- a/gcc/target-gfortran.add
+++ b/gcc/target-gfortran.add
@@ -13,6 +13,10 @@ Requires:       @rpmprefix at gcc-gfortran-common
 %endif
 Requires:       @rpmprefix@@tool_target at -gcc = %{gcc_rpmvers}-%{release}
 Requires:       @rpmprefix@@tool_target at -gcc-libgfortran = %{gcc_rpmvers}-%{release}
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-gfortran <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-gfortran =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-gfortran
 GCC fortran compiler for @tool_target at .
@@ -42,6 +46,10 @@ Group:          Development/Tools
 Version:        %{gcc_rpmvers}
 %{?_with_noarch_subpackages:BuildArch: noarch}
 License:	GPL
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-libgfortran <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-libgfortran =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-libgfortran
 %{summary}
diff --git a/gcc/target-gnat.add b/gcc/target-gnat.add
index 3e034a5..1ec73b7 100644
--- a/gcc/target-gnat.add
+++ b/gcc/target-gnat.add
@@ -12,6 +12,10 @@ License:	GPL
 Requires:       @rpmprefix at gcc-gnat-common
 %endif
 Requires:       @rpmprefix@@tool_target at -gcc = %{gcc_rpmvers}-%{release}
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-gnat <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-gnat =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-gnat
 RTEMS is an open source operating system for embedded systems.
diff --git a/gcc/target-go.add b/gcc/target-go.add
index 928bd30..2fad5af 100644
--- a/gcc/target-go.add
+++ b/gcc/target-go.add
@@ -12,6 +12,10 @@ License:	GPL
 Requires:       @rpmprefix at gcc-go-common
 %endif
 Requires:       @rpmprefix@@tool_target at -gcc = %{gcc_rpmvers}-%{release}
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-go <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-go =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-go
 RTEMS is an open source operating system for embedded systems.
diff --git a/gcc/target-newlib.add b/gcc/target-newlib.add
index 50efe08..dbcbfbc 100644
--- a/gcc/target-newlib.add
+++ b/gcc/target-newlib.add
@@ -13,6 +13,10 @@ Release:        @NEWLIB_RPMREL@
 %if %build_infos
 Requires:	@rpmprefix at newlib-common
 %endif
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-newlib < %{newlib_version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-newlib = %{newlib_version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-newlib
 Newlib C Library for @tool_target at .
diff --git a/gcc/target-objc.add b/gcc/target-objc.add
index 41a5e81..26074c9 100644
--- a/gcc/target-objc.add
+++ b/gcc/target-objc.add
@@ -10,6 +10,10 @@ License:	GPL
 
 Requires:       @rpmprefix@@tool_target at -gcc = %{gcc_rpmvers}-%{release}
 Requires:       @rpmprefix@@tool_target at -gcc-libobjc = %{gcc_rpmvers}-%{release}
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-objc <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-objc =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-objc
 GCC objc compiler for @tool_target at .
@@ -32,6 +36,10 @@ Group:          Development/Tools
 Version:        %{gcc_rpmvers}
 %{?_with_noarch_subpackages:BuildArch: noarch}
 License:	GPL
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gcc-libobjc <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gcc-libobjc = %{version}-%{release}
+%endif
 
 %description -n @rpmprefix@@tool_target at -gcc-libobjc
 Support libraries for GCC's objc compiler for @tool_target at .
diff --git a/gdb/gdb.add b/gdb/gdb.add
index fbd66f0..541a8ef 100644
--- a/gdb/gdb.add
+++ b/gdb/gdb.add
@@ -91,6 +91,11 @@ Requires:	@rpmprefix at gdb-common
 %endif
 BuildRequires:	%{?suse:makeinfo}%{!?suse:texinfo}
 
+%if "@tool_target@" == "arm-rtems4.11"
+Obsoletes:	@rpmprefix at arm-rtemseabi4.11-gdb < %{version}-%{release}
+Provides:	@rpmprefix at arm-rtemseabi4.11-gdb = %{version}-%{release}
+
+%endif
 @SOURCES@
 
 %description




More information about the vc mailing list